Embodiment 1
[0035] First, the foam masterbatch is manufactured. Weigh raw materials according to the following mass: LDPE: 0.58kg, AC: 0.2kg, ZnO: 0.02kg, high melting point PE wax: 0.1kg, talcum powder: 0.1kg. After the raw materials are dried separately, they are mixed uniformly in a mixer and a foam masterbatch is obtained through a twin-screw extruder, and the melt temperature is 130°C during the extrusion process;
[0036] Next, prepare the PP / ABS mixture. Weigh the dried raw materials according to the following mass: PP: 1kg, ABS: 0.1kg, PE-c-GMA: 0.02kg, nano-montmorillonite: 0.02kg, high melting point PE wax: 0.05kg. These raw materials are mixed uniformly in a mixer to form a PP / ABS compound, and then melted, extruded and pelletized through an ordinary plastic extruder, and the melt temperature is controlled at 180°C during the extrusion process;
